Abstract :
In this paper we design a Chaos Bidirectional Associative Memory (CBAM) network model based on Aihara chaos neuron for its sensitivity to noise. It includes an inside associative memory construct on its every layer. The simulation shows that the model improves the anti-noise ability of the BAM effectively.
